## Alert: StatRelay Sidecar Flush Lag

This alert fires when the StatRelay metrics-aggregation sidecar falls more than 120 seconds behind on flushing buffered samples to the Coalmine backend. Plugin-emitted counters are buffered in-process, so sustained lag usually means a plugin is emitting unbounded label cardinality or blocking the flush thread. Check your plugin's metric registration against the published cardinality limits before escalating. If the lag persists after your plugin is ruled out, contact the telemetry team.

escalation mailbox, bagug-fahof: novdor.wendor.jormir@norvalabs.example

## Deployment

Before deploying Tollgate's payment service, confirm the idempotency key store is reachable from every region you target. Retried payment requests reuse their original key, so a missing store entry can cause duplicate charges. Run the preflight check script first, every time. The deployment applies the following configuration values.

deployment values, yadup-kadug:
[sorys]
port = 5672
team = noveth
host = sorys.orvexcorp.example
region = south-4
access_code = ac_deddc1
timeout_ms = 1500

## Auth Setup

The breaker wraps calls to the Pondwater upstream API and trips after five consecutive failures. Heads up for reviewers: the breaker itself phones home to our internal Fusebox dashboard to report state changes, and that call needs its own credential — don't confuse it with the upstream token. For local testing against staging Fusebox, use the key below.

app token of kafop-hahaf = kto11_iRLdsMBafGn

Subject: Quickstore 4.2 — bloom filter now fronts the KV layer

Plugin authors: starting with this release, Quickstore places a bloom filter ahead of the key-value store. Negative lookups return faster; false positives fall through safely. No API changes are required on your side. Verify your plugin against the staging build referenced below.

session token of fahif-tadup = htk3_9c7